Real Estate Agent in Loveland - Enchantment Ridge Neighborhood
The Enchantment Ridge homes subdivision is located in northwest Loveland, where there is next to no traffic and acres of open and undisturbed space and hiking trails for residents to enjoy. Enchantment Ridge homes were first built in the early 1990's, and current homeowners who are part of the real estate market looking to sell have done a great job in keeping them modern and new. Since Enchantment Ridge homes were built close to thirty years ago, however, they unsurprisingly enter the market at the low to mid-price point, making them a great real estate opportunity for any interested buyer looking at houses in the Northern Colorado region. Enchantment Ridge homes come in 1, 2, 3, and 4 Bedroom, 1, 2, and 3 Bathroom layouts, and range anywhere from 2,100 square feet to 3,700 square feet.

Enchantment Ridge homes are located in one of the country’s best public school districts in Thompson School District. Being in Thompson School District ensures Enchantment Ridge homes residents that their children will have the opportunity to earn a highly valued education as well as access to fantastic extracurricular educational programs. Thompson School District is a "school of choice" district where Enchantment Ridge parents are able to choose whatever school they want their children to attend. With this being said, the closest schools to Enchantment Ridge homes include B F Kitchen Elementary School, Centennial Elementary School, Coyote Ridge Elementary School, Edmundson Elementary School, Monroe Elementary School, Ponderosa Elementary School, Stansberry Elementary School, Lucille Erwin Middle School, and Loveland High School. Thompson School District provides Enchantment Ridge homes residents free bus transportation to and from their schools if needed. If Enchantment Ridge homes residents want to, they can choose to send their children to Fort Collins’ award-winning Poudre School District instead of Thompson School District, but they would need to drive their children to these schools as Poudre School District does not service the Enchantment Ridge homes neighborhood with bus transportation.
There are countless advantages to living in northwest Loveland that Enchantment Ridge homes residents get to enjoy. The most obvious advantage comes in the vast amount of open space in the surrounding foothills and the amount of outdoor activities that are available to Enchantment Ridge homes residents. A few miles north of the Enchantment Ridge homes subdivision are some of the area’s nicest paved walking trails that go from the base of the foothills and curve several miles east. Along these trails, which Enchantment Ridge homes residents can walk, jog, or bike along, one will be able to view wildlife including deer, prairie dogs, coyotes, beavers, muskrats, hawks, and even eagles, as well as take in the glorious Colorado sunsets or sunrises every day. For a less relaxed and more adventurous outdoor experience, Enchantment Ridge homes residents can travel a few miles southwest to the Devil’s Backbone foothills and mountain area where they can challenge themselves with some more difficult, yet rewarding hiking adventures.
